As a Mercator Fellow, Leonie Harsch works on strengthening the role of local actors, such as local NGOs or church and mosque communities, in international humanitarian cooperation. During her fellowship year, she can build on her experiences from two years of fieldwork with refugees and host communities in Lebanon and Germany, a year in a grassroots organization in the Indian Himalaya and her work with the UN’s regional commission for Western Asia. Leonie Harsch holds a MSc in Migration Studies from the University of Oxford. She has also studied International Literatures and Middle Eastern Studies in Tuebingen, Aix-Marseille and at IFPO Beirut.
